Description
This Creamy Tomato Soup is a comforting and flavorful dish perfect for chilly days. Made with ripe tomatoes, aromatic herbs, and creamy coconut milk, it’s a dairy-free twist on the classic favorite. Serve piping hot with a side of crusty bread for a satisfying meal.
Ingredients
Units
Scale
For the soup:
- 6 large ripe tomatoes, chopped
- 1 onion, diced
- 3 cloves garlic, minced
- 2 cups vegetable broth
- 1 can (14 oz) coconut milk
- 2 tablespoons olive oil
- 1 teaspoon dried basil
- 1 teaspoon dried oregano
- Salt and pepper to taste
For garnish:
- Fresh basil leaves
- Cracked black pepper
- Coconut cream (optional)
Instructions
- Sautรฉ the aromatics: In a large pot, heat olive oil over medium heat. Add the diced onion and minced garlic, sautรฉing until fragrant.
- Add the tomatoes: Stir in the chopped tomatoes and cook until they start to break down.
- Season the soup: Add vegetable broth, dried basil, dried oregano, salt, and pepper. Let the soup simmer for about 15-20 minutes.
- Blend the soup: Using an immersion blender, blend the soup until smooth. Alternatively, transfer the soup to a blender in batches and blend until creamy.
- Finish with coconut milk: Stir in the coconut milk, adjusting seasoning if needed. Let the soup simmer for an additional 5-10 minutes.
- Serve: Ladle the creamy tomato soup into bowls and garnish with fresh basil leaves, cracked black pepper, and a drizzle of coconut cream, if desired. Serve hot and enjoy!
Notes
- You can customize the soup by adding a pinch of red pepper flakes for a spicy kick.
- For a smoother consistency, strain the soup through a fine mesh sieve after blending.
Nutrition
- Serving Size: 1 serving
- Calories: 230 kcal
- Sugar: 9g
- Sodium: 680mg
- Fat: 18g
- Saturated Fat: 14g
- Unsaturated Fat: 3g
- Trans Fat: 0g
- Carbohydrates: 17g
- Fiber: 4g
- Protein: 4g
- Cholesterol: 0mg